Carterville, Provo, UT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Carterville?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Carterville Studio Apartments | $1,313 | $925 | $1,518 |
| Carterville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,339 | $350 | $1,805 |
| Carterville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,577 | $325 | $2,308 |
| Carterville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,009 | $540 | $4,275 |
| Carterville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$944 | $450 | $2,350 |
How much does it cost to rent a home in Carterville?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$1,338 | $390 | $1,850 |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$1,593 | $500 | $3,000 |
| 4 Bedroom Homes | $1,733 | $450 | $3,500 |
| 5 Bedroom Homes | $2,719 | $1,950 | $2,995 |
| 6 Bedroom Homes | $2,392 | $575 | $3,400 |
